Официальное название
Clinical Study to Evaluate the Impact of the Accu-Chek SmartGuide CGM Solution on the Mean Change in Time in Range of 70 - 180 mg/dl Compared to SMBG
Обзор
This is an open label, two-arm, randomized multi-center clinical device study in adult subjects with Type 1 diabetes (T1D) or insulin-dependent Type 2 diabetes (T2D) on a multiple daily injection (MDI) regime. The goal of the study is to investigate the impact of the Accu-Chek SmartGuide CGM solution on the change in overall time in range (TIR) of blood glucose concentrations of 70-180 mg/dl compared with that using self-monitoring of blood glucose (SMBG).
Вмешательства
- Устройство Accu-Chek SmartGuide CGM Solution
The Accu-Chek SmartGuide CGM solution is used for real-time continuous glucose monitoring (CGM) in the interstitial fluid. It consists of the Accu-Chek SmartGuide device and two smartphone applications (apps): the Accu-Chek SmartGuide app and the Accu-Chek SmartGuide Predict app. The Accu-Chek SmartGuide device contains a CGM sensor pre-assembled in a sensor applicator. The participants in the SMBG control group will wear a SmartGuide sensor with blinded SmartGuide apps intermittently, i.e., during the assessment periods. It is not possible to read out the glucose data from the blinded app, hence neither the SmartGuide app nor the SmartGuide Predict functionalities can be accessed by the participants in this group. - Устройство SMBG Device
With the SmartGuide apps in blinded mode, participants in the SMBG control group will continue using their own SMBG device or they may use the Accu-Chek Instant meter that will be provided for calibration of the SmartGuide device.

Критерии участия
Критерии включения
- Type 1 Diabetes mellitus (T1D) or Type 2 Diabetes mellitus (T2D) diagnosed at least 12 months prior to screening, using multiple daily injection (MDI) regime for at least six months prior to screening
- Performing SMBG, no CGM/flash glucose monitoring (FGM) use during the last six months prior screening
- HbA1c ≥8% and ≤10% based on analysis from a local laboratory
Критерии исключения
- Untreated adrenal or thyroid insufficiency
- Severe visual impairment
- Significant renal impairment: eGFR <30 ml/min within last one year
- Serious acute or chronic concomitant disease or an anamnesis which might, in the opinion of the investigator, pose a risk to the subject
- Hematocrit greater than 10% below the lower limit of normal
- Pregnancy (lack of negative pregnancy test - except in case of menopause, sterilization or hysterectomy - self-reported), planned pregnancy, or breast feeding
- Allergic to the adhesive (glue or tape)
- Skin diseases (e.g. psoriasis vulgaris, bacterial skin diseases) at the sensor application sites
- Sickle cell disease, or hemoglobinopathy
- Elective surgery planned that requires general anesthesia during study participation
- Current or anticipated acute uses of glucocorticoids (oral, injectable, or intravenous)
- Medical conditions that, per investigator determination, make it inappropriate or unsafe to target an HbA1c of <7%. Conditions may include but are not limited to: heart failure, unstable cardiovascular disease, recent myocardial infarction, ventricular rhythm disturbances, recent transient ischemic attack or cerebrovascular accident, significant malignancy
- Chronic use of opiates, opioids, morphinomimetics more than three times per week, which has not stopped at least 30 days prior to screening and any other medication interfering with the assessment of pain, as per investigator's discretion
- Intake of hydroxyurea (hydroxycarbamide), levodopa, methyldopa, ascorbic acid, acetylsalicylic acid (≥300mg), which has not stopped at least 30 days prior to screening
- Magnetic resonance tomography (MRT), computed tomography (CT), X-ray, radiofrequency ablation, high-frequency electrical heat or high intensity focused ultrasound planned during the course of the study
- Planned flight or high-altitude hike (>3000 m) during baseline and assessment periods
- Shift-worker (night-shifts)
- On or planning to start a diet intended for weight change
- Currently abusing illicit and/or prescription drugs or alcohol as judged by the investigator
- Any other physical or psychological disease or psychiatric disorder that could limit adherence to the required study tasks and interfere with the normal conduct of the study as judged by the investigator
- Dependency (e.g., employee, co-worker or family member) on sponsor, investigator or companies active in the field of CGM (e.g. Dexcom, Abbott, Menarini, Medtronic) or their subsidiaries
- Participation in another clinical study at the same time
